Revision: 41804
http://brlcad.svn.sourceforge.net/brlcad/?rev=41804&view=rev
Author: brlcad
Date: 2010-12-27 23:21:17 +0000 (Mon, 27 Dec 2010)
Log Message:
-----------
make a handful of mged functions specify a proper const argv array. mark
unused params too.
Modified Paths:
--------------
brlcad/trunk/src/mged/chgview.c
brlcad/trunk/src/mged/cmd.h
Modified: brlcad/trunk/src/mged/chgview.c
===================================================================
--- brlcad/trunk/src/mged/chgview.c 2010-12-27 23:08:26 UTC (rev 41803)
+++ brlcad/trunk/src/mged/chgview.c 2010-12-27 23:21:17 UTC (rev 41804)
@@ -133,10 +133,10 @@
/* DEBUG -- force view center */
/* Format: C x y z */
int
-cmd_center(ClientData clientData,
+cmd_center(ClientData UNUSED(clientData),
Tcl_Interp *interp,
int argc,
- char **argv)
+ const char *argv[])
{
int ret;
Tcl_DString ds;
@@ -483,7 +483,7 @@
int
-emuves_com(int argc, char **argv)
+emuves_com(int argc, const char *argv[])
{
int i;
struct bu_ptbl *tbl;
@@ -4068,7 +4068,7 @@
int
-cmd_rot(ClientData clientData,
+cmd_rot(ClientData UNUSED(clientData),
Tcl_Interp *interp,
int argc,
char **argv)
@@ -4115,7 +4115,7 @@
cmd_arot(ClientData clientData,
Tcl_Interp *interp,
int argc,
- char **argv)
+ const char *argv[])
{
Tcl_DString ds;
static const char *usage = "x y z angle";
Modified: brlcad/trunk/src/mged/cmd.h
===================================================================
--- brlcad/trunk/src/mged/cmd.h 2010-12-27 23:08:26 UTC (rev 41803)
+++ brlcad/trunk/src/mged/cmd.h 2010-12-27 23:21:17 UTC (rev 41804)
@@ -48,14 +48,14 @@
BU_EXTERN(int cmd_ged_more_wrapper, (ClientData, Tcl_Interp *, int, const char
*[]));
BU_EXTERN(int cmd_ged_plain_wrapper, (ClientData, Tcl_Interp *, int, const
char *[]));
BU_EXTERN(int cmd_ged_view_wrapper, (ClientData, Tcl_Interp *, int, const char
*[]));
-BU_EXTERN(int cmd_E, (ClientData, Tcl_Interp *, int, const char **));
-BU_EXTERN(int cmd_arot, (ClientData, Tcl_Interp *, int, char **));
+BU_EXTERN(int cmd_E, (ClientData, Tcl_Interp *, int, const char *[]));
+BU_EXTERN(int cmd_arot, (ClientData, Tcl_Interp *, int, const char *[]));
BU_EXTERN(int cmd_autoview, (ClientData, Tcl_Interp *, int, const char *[]));
BU_EXTERN(int cmd_blast, (ClientData, Tcl_Interp *, int, const char *[]));
-BU_EXTERN(int cmd_center, (ClientData, Tcl_Interp *, int, char **));
-BU_EXTERN(int cmd_cmd_win, (ClientData, Tcl_Interp *, int, char **));
+BU_EXTERN(int cmd_center, (ClientData, Tcl_Interp *, int, const char *[]));
+BU_EXTERN(int cmd_cmd_win, (ClientData, Tcl_Interp *, int, const char *[]));
BU_EXTERN(int cmd_draw, (ClientData, Tcl_Interp *, int, const char *[]));
-BU_EXTERN(int cmd_emuves, (ClientData, Tcl_Interp *, int, char **));
+BU_EXTERN(int cmd_emuves, (ClientData, Tcl_Interp *, int, const char *[]));
BU_EXTERN(int cmd_ev, (ClientData, Tcl_Interp *, int, const char *[]));
BU_EXTERN(int cmd_export_body, (ClientData, Tcl_Interp *, int, char **));
BU_EXTERN(int cmd_get, (ClientData, Tcl_Interp *, int, char **));
This was sent by the SourceForge.net collaborative development platform, the
world's largest Open Source development site.
------------------------------------------------------------------------------
Learn how Oracle Real Application Clusters (RAC) One Node allows customers
to consolidate database storage, standardize their database environment, and,
should the need arise, upgrade to a full multi-node Oracle RAC database
without downtime or disruption
http://p.sf.net/sfu/oracle-sfdevnl
_______________________________________________
BRL-CAD Source Commits mailing list
[email protected]
https://lists.sourceforge.net/lists/listinfo/brlcad-commits